The Mathematics Talent Search Examination (MTSE) is a competitive assessment aimed at identifying and nurturing mathematical talent among school students. It is conducted in various regions, particularly in India, to encourage young minds to develop problem-solving skills, logical reasoning, and a deep interest in mathematics. The exam serves as a platform for recognizing gifted students and often provides opportunities for participation in higher-level competitions or mentorship programs.
